About PowerUp Acquisition Corp
Exchange NASDAQ | Headquaters New York, NY, United States | ||
IPO Launch date 2022-04-11 | CEO & Executive Chairman Mr. Surendra K. Ajjarapu | ||
Sector Financial Services | Industry Shell Companies | Full time employees - | Website https://www.powerupacq.com |
Full time employees - | Website https://www.powerupacq.com |
PowerUp Acquisition Corp. does not have significant operations. The company focuses on effecting a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, share pur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more businesses. It intends to focus on video gaming, gaming adjacent, and metaverse businesses. PowerUp Acquisition Corp. was incorporated in 2021 and is based in New York, New York.
